ANN's Daily Aero-Term (04.17.06): DA

Aero-Terms!

Decision Altitude. It replaces the term Decision Height (DH). With the adoption of the new approach plate, the US will harmonize with international terminology.

Aero-News Quote Of The Day (04.17.06)

“Over the past 60 years, the people of Guidong County, have quietly watched and tended the grave of Lieutenant Upchurch, who has been a hero commanding their highest respect and a symbol in their mind for everlasting pursuit of peace.” 

Source: Haung Renzhun, a representative from the Foreign Affairs Office of the Hunan Provincial Government, speaking about 2nd Lt. Robert Upchurch, a member of the famed Flying Tigers, who was lost defending them, over 61 years ago. Mr. Renzhun said that every year during “Tomb-Sweeping Day,” local students and citizens voluntarily came to pay their respects and lay wreaths and flowers at the tomb of the unknown pilot.
